Position Overview
The Network Engineer will support comprehensive 24x7x365 Network Operations Center (NOC)
and Cyber Security Operations Center (CSOC) services to ensure the continuous availability,
security, performance, and operational integrity of the organization’s enterprise infrastructure.
This position will provide advanced troubleshooting and operational engineering support across
network, cloud, infrastructure, and security environments. The Network Engineer will investigate
complex incidents, correlate information across monitoring and security platforms, support
maintenance and infrastructure changes, validate service availability, coordinate escalations, and
identify opportunities for technical and operational improvement.

• Demonstrated significant experience with Microsoft Sentinel, including alert monitoring,
KQL log queries, entity analysis, runbooks, or escalation.
• Demonstrated significant experience with Microsoft Azure, including portal navigation,
Monitor/Log Analytics, VMs, Resource Health, or basic networking such as VNets/NSGs.
• Demonstrated significant experience with networking fundamentals, including TCP/IP,
DNS/DHCP, subnetting, VLANs, routing, firewalls, VPNs, or LAN/WAN.
• Demonstrated significant experience troubleshooting outages, connectivity issues, packet
loss/latency, or CPU/memory issues.
• Demonstrated experience with tools for topology, paths, assets, segmentation, or
vulnerabilities.
• Demonstrated experience with Kusto Query Language (KQL) for searching, filtering,
correlating, and investigating Microsoft Sentinel and Log Analytics data.
